Sequence of Operation

Abnormal Operation (cont’d)

2.Temperature Sensor Fault:

A)Temperature Sensor Open Circuit: The gas control immediately turns off all out- puts and proceeds to flash 8 times then 3 times with a three second pause. The error self clears if the fault clears for at least 15 seconds.

B) Thermal well sensors not reading the same temperature within ±5.5°F: The gas control immediately turns off all outputs and proceeds to flash 8 times then 3 times with three second pause. The error self clears if the fault clears for at least 15 sec- onds.

C)Water Temperature in excess of ECO (Energy Cut Off) Limit: The gas control immediately turns off the pilot and main valves. The gas control LED proceeds to flash 4 times with a 3 second pause.

To reset the gas control, rotate the setpoint knob to the minimum setting for at least 6 seconds before returning to desired temperature setting.

3.Damper Safety Circuit Fault:

A)Damper Failed to Open: The gas control proceeds to flash 3 times with a three second pause. The gas control waits 5 minutes, and then tries to open the damper again.

B)Damper Failed to Close: The gas control proceeds to flash 2 times with a three second pause. The gas control waits 5 minutes, and then tries to open the damper again.

4.Trial for Ignition Fault:

A)Damper Jostled During Trial: The gas control stops the trial for ignition. The gas control proceeds to flash 3 times with a three second pause. The gas control waits 5 minutes, and then tries to open the damper again.

B)Flame Not Sensed: The gas control energizes the spark igniter attempting to light the pilot and prove flame. If flame is not sensed within 90 seconds, the spark igniter turns off, the pilot valve is closed. The gas control LED flashes 6 times then 1 time with 3 second pause. The control waits 5 minutes before re- peating the ignition sequence.

Bradford-White Corp has long been a pioneering name in the water heating industry, and their D4403S*F(BN, D4504S*F(BN, and SX models represent the company’s commitment to delivering high-quality, efficient solutions for residential and commercial applications. These water heaters are designed with various user needs in mind, ensuring that homeowners and businesses can enjoy a reliable hot water supply whenever needed.

One of the core features of these models is their advanced water heating technology. Utilizing power venting systems, these units ensure efficient heat transfer while minimizing heat loss. This technology promotes energy efficiency and helps users save on their energy bills. The power vent system also allows for flexible installation options, accommodating different types of venting configurations, which is especially useful in homes with unique designs or limited space.

The Bradford-White D4403S*F(BN and D4504S*F(BN models are equipped with their state-of-the-art Hydrojet Total Performance System. This feature not only enhances the heater's overall performance but also reduces sediment buildup within the tank, which can significantly extend the unit's lifespan and maintain efficiency over time. Moreover, the patented Vitraglas® lining protects the inner tank from corrosion, further prolonging the life of the appliance.

Safety is a paramount consideration in Bradford-White's design philosophy. Each model includes a robust Flammable Vapor Ignition Resistance (FVIR) system, which helps prevent the ignition of flammable vapors that may be present in the vicinity of the water heater. This feature meets stringent safety standards and provides peace of mind to users.

In terms of energy specifications, both the D4403S*F(BN and D4504S*F(BN models are designed to meet or exceed efficiency standards, contributing to lower energy consumption and environmental impact. The SX model is particularly notable for its user-friendly digital display and controls, allowing for easy temperature adjustments and efficient operation monitoring.
